Montreal Impact are "willing to accommodate" Didier Drogba's desire to help his former club Chelsea but expect the striker to return to Major League Soccer action next year.
The 37-year-old Ivorian joined the Impact in July, at the end of his second spell with the Blues, and he has been successful in Canada with a haul of 11 goals from 11 appearances.
The 2016 MLS season begins in March but Chelsea are currently talking to Montreal with a view to securing Drogba's services in a possible coaching role under interim boss Guus Hiddink, who replaced Jose Mourinho last week.
